What is a Ceiling Access Panel?
A ceiling access panel is a removable section of ceiling material that provides access to plumbing, electrical wiring, HVAC systems, and other utilities concealed above the ceiling. The 12x12 panel size strikes a balance between accessibility and aesthetics, allowing users to reach necessary maintenance points without compromising the overall integrity and look of the ceiling.
Benefits of Using 12x12 Ceiling Access Panels
1. Easy Access The primary benefit of a ceiling access panel is that it offers straightforward access to crucial systems for maintenance and repairs. A 12x12 panel provides ample room for professionals or homeowners to inspect and work on plumbing, ductwork, or electrical infrastructure without needing to cut into the ceiling extensively.
2. Space Efficiency In smaller spaces where larger access panels may be impractical, a 12x12 panel is space-efficient. It minimizes disruption to the ceiling structure while still providing enough space for hands and tools to reach necessary components.
3. Aesthetic Integration Many ceiling access panels are designed to blend seamlessly with the surrounding ceiling. With a variety of finishes and materials available, a 12x12 access panel can be painted or covered to maintain the aesthetics of the room, making it an unobtrusive addition to the design.
4. Cost-Effective Solution Installing a 12x12 access panel is generally a cost-effective solution for building maintenance. It eliminates the need for larger, more complex access points and minimizes the damage that may occur from unnecessary ceiling modifications.
Installation Considerations
When installing a 12x12 ceiling access panel, there are a few essential considerations to keep in mind
1. Location Choose a location that minimizes visibility while still being accessible for maintenance personnel. Avoid placing panels directly in line with lights or other fixtures.
2. Safety Ensure that the installation complies with local building codes and safety regulations. Proper installation will help avoid future issues related to the panel’s structural integrity.
3. Sealing and Insulation Depending on the area above the ceiling, consider sealing and insulating to prevent energy loss and maintain indoor air quality.
